Frequently Asked Questions
How much does Indiana University-Southeast cost?
Indiana University-Southeast has out-of-state tuition of $22,043 and an average net price of $8,257 after financial aid per year. The net price reflects average grants and scholarships.
What is the net price of Indiana University-Southeast?
The average net price at Indiana University-Southeast is $8,257 per year after grants and scholarships are applied. This is the amount the average student actually pays, which is often significantly less than the sticker price.
How much debt do Indiana University-Southeast graduates typically carry?
The median federal loan debt for Indiana University-Southeast graduates is $19,684. With median earnings of $47,596 ten years after graduation, this represents a manageable debt-to-income ratio for most graduates.
